A life that made headlines

Eight United Methodist bishops, friends and colleagues gathered at Ann Arbor First United Methodist Church on December 12 to remember and honor the life of Bishop Jesse DeWitt.

Speakers celebrated DeWitt’s deep faith and told stories of his life in an auto factory, on the street marching for justice and in the sanctuary seated in his favorite pew.

The day’s main message, shared by Bishop Donald Ott, drew on the story of Zacchaeus. “I see Jesse in what Jesus did that day,” Ott said, ” … Jesus was curious about the man up the tree.”
